Why password managers matter now
Password reuse is still one of the most common ways accounts get compromised, and it has become harder to avoid as people juggle work apps, banking, shopping, and subscriptions across multiple devices. A password manager reduces that risk by generating unique, high-entropy passwords and storing them in an encrypted vault that you unlock with one strong master password or device-based authentication. In 2026, the value is not only stronger passwords; it is also speed and consistency. Autofill reduces typing on mobile, and built-in password health checks flag weak or reused credentials. Many managers now include secure notes for recovery codes, identity documents, and software licenses, which helps keep sensitive data out of email drafts and screenshots. How modern managers work
Most password managers rely on end-to-end encryption: your vault is encrypted on your device before it syncs, and the provider cannot read its contents. The practical difference between products often shows up in how they handle device onboarding, recovery, and browser integration. Look for support across major browsers, reliable autofill on iOS and Android, and a clear security model that explains what happens when you forget your master password. Some services offer account recovery options such as emergency access contacts, recovery keys, or device-based recovery, while others intentionally avoid recovery to reduce attack surface. Another key component is the password generator. A good generator lets you control length, character sets, and passphrase style, and it should default to long passwords rather than the minimum allowed by older websites. Finally, pay attention to how the manager stores and labels items: logins, passkeys, payment cards, addresses, and secure notes. Good organization reduces mistakes, especially when you manage multiple accounts on the same domain for work and personal use.
Choosing the right manager
Start with your real constraints: devices, browsers, and whether you need a family or team plan. If you use Windows at work and an iPhone personally, cross-platform reliability matters more than niche features. For families, prioritize shared vaults with granular permissions, so you can share streaming logins or home Wi‑Fi details without exposing everything. For small teams, look for admin controls, offboarding workflows, and audit logs that show when credentials were changed. Evaluate security signals that are easy to verify: independent security audits, a published vulnerability disclosure program, and a track record of timely updates. Also check usability details that affect adoption: fast search, clean item templates, and a frictionless way to save new logins. Pricing should be judged against the cost of account recovery and downtime; a modest subscription can be cheaper than dealing with locked accounts. Finally, consider data portability. Export options and clear import tools make it easier to switch later, which reduces the risk of getting stuck with a tool you outgrow.
Setup checklist for a safer vault
A strong setup is mostly about a few decisions made early. First, create a master password that is long and memorable, ideally a passphrase with multiple unrelated words, and never reuse it anywhere else. Enable multi-factor authentication for the manager account, preferably using an authenticator app or hardware key rather than SMS. Turn on automatic lock with a short timeout on mobile and laptops, and require device biometrics where available. Next, import existing passwords carefully. After import, run the built-in security report to identify reused or weak passwords, then prioritize changing the most sensitive accounts first: email, banking, cloud storage, and social accounts tied to recovery. Store recovery codes in the vault and keep an offline copy in a secure physical location, such as a locked drawer, in case you lose access to your devices. Finally, review autofill settings. Restrict autofill to trusted domains, and disable automatic filling on pages that look suspicious. These steps take less than an hour but dramatically reduce the chance that a single mistake cascades across your digital life.
Passkeys and the future of sign-in
Passkeys are becoming a mainstream alternative to passwords, and many password managers now store and sync them alongside traditional logins. A passkey typically uses public-key cryptography and is tied to your device authentication, such as biometrics or a device PIN, which reduces exposure to phishing and credential stuffing. In practice, adoption is uneven: some services support passkeys fully, others offer them only on certain platforms, and some still require a password as a fallback. A practical approach in 2026 is hybrid. Use passkeys where they are supported for high-value accounts, keep strong unique passwords for the rest, and maintain multi-factor authentication as an additional layer when available. Also pay attention to portability: understand whether your passkeys are stored only on a device, synced through an ecosystem, or managed by your password manager. The best outcome is convenience without lock-in, so you can change phones or platforms without losing access.
Common mistakes and how to avoid them
The most common mistake is treating the manager as a storage box rather than a system. If you keep old weak passwords and never rotate them, you miss most of the benefit. Schedule a monthly 15-minute review to change a few high-risk passwords and clean up duplicates. Another mistake is ignoring account recovery. If you do not store recovery codes or set up emergency access, a lost phone can become a long outage. Configure recovery options immediately and test them in a controlled way. People also get tripped up by multiple accounts on the same site; use clear naming conventions like “Work Google” and “Personal Google,” and add notes for required login steps. Finally, be cautious with browser extensions on shared computers. If you must use a shared device, use a private browsing session, avoid saving the vault unlock state, and lock the manager when you step away. A password manager is most effective when it is consistently used with disciplined habits, not when it is installed and forgotten.
